Output 681157604a0a9520d8d41b4f7516b39c29f760608256708102fa18c4b6f176bc:0

value
2042315
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c2d925b0b3aada763453084aaf88915e1f389934 OP_EQUALVERIFY OP_CHECKSIG
address
1JmGDsQE2srTJAhaLXxbjoAh4KjGqn423k
transaction
681157604a0a9520d8d41b4f7516b39c29f760608256708102fa18c4b6f176bc
confirmations
504218
spent
true